7 Lit. Circle Directions for today
Divide up the roles for the first discussion – give each person their handout to prepare Discussion Director – prepares THOUGHTFUL questions to lead the group Literary Luminary – find passages that are the most important to talk about – lead discussion about them Investigator – research background information on a topic related to your book and teach it to the group Summarizer – prepare a summary, major points, and connection (**leave this one out if you only have 3 people). **If you have 5 people, choose to repeat either the Discussion Director, Literary Luminary, or Investigator Fill out the top part of the handout (no group name needed) Meeting Date: 2/2 Assignment pages: Divide your book into three parts, decide which pages you will read by next Friday.
